Feature MAGGI Mexican Nachos at your next Family dinner. MAGGI Recipe Bases make it easy to create healthy, balanced meals that taste great for you and your family. Just add – beef mince, onion, tomatoes, corn chip, cheese and sour cream. Tip: For a gluten free meal, substitute with gluten free corn chips.

Alternative Use: I did not need a meat dish, so instead I used this as a spicy potato flavouring – great! Chop chunks of unpeeled potatoes and add to a plastic bag with a slosh of oil and a spoon of this spice. Toss and bake – delicious!
